Online Inductor Calculator
Hi all,
I am contemplating DIYing my own air-core inductor. Searched the web and found a few sites but really don't know which calculator gives the correct results.
The results from different sites seem to vary, some having very significant differences in their results compared to others.
I don't need very sophisticated calculators. A simple but reliable one will do. Any suggestions?

Re: Online Inductor Calculator
i find that online inductance calculator aren't really precise. the most precise online calculator for iron toroid that i've used are off by 2%.
best to invest in an LCR meter. a few percent off from the inductor and another few percent from the capacitor and there's gonna be a void in the frequency response. they're perfectly fine for output filters tho, as some inductor don't need an exactly value.
if you're thinking of buying an LCR meter, get the 3 1/2 LCR meter from Pro's Kit. less than RM200 and it's spec-ed to be precise to 1% for low inductance and less than 3% (or issit 5% can't remember) for higher inductance.
better precision compared to other models in the same price range. and it also could measure capacitance with better precision than most multimeters.
